Midlife Athletes: Mastering the DASH Diet, Avoiding Mistakes & Breaking Plateaus

Midlife athletes face unique metabolic challenges as they balance training demands with age-related shifts in insulin sensitivity, muscle preservation, and recovery. The DASH (Dietary Approaches to Stop Hypertension) diet, originally developed to lower blood pressure, offers a powerful framework for this group when properly adapted. Rich in vegetables, fruits, lean proteins, and whole grains while limiting sodium and processed foods, DASH emphasizes nutrient density that supports performance and metabolic health. Common Mistakes That Derail Progress

Many midlife athletes misapply DASH by treating it as a low-calorie plan rather than a nutrient-timing system, leading to under-fueling during training and triggering adaptive thermogenesis. A frequent error is ignoring CICO fundamentals—underestimating calories from cooking oils, dressings, or beverages while over-relying on inaccurate fitness trackers that inflate Calories Out by 20–40%. This creates hidden surpluses that stall fat loss despite meticulous food logging.
